Led by Western Athletic Conference Swimmer of the Week Madelyn Moore for the first time in the history of Northern Colorado Swimming and Diving, they appear in the top-25 of College Swimming's Mid-Major rankings.
Northern Colorado comes in at No. 22.
"Our team has shown a lot of resilience this year and it's beginning to pay off through our performances," said head coach Lisa Ebeling. "This is a big step for our program, but we have a lot of unfinished work to do. If we can all stay healthy and focused, we hope that it will be the first of many." The ranking comes off the heels of a dominant weekend for Ebeling's squad. Northern Colorado won 13 events across two days of dual meets against Air Force, Colorado Mesa and the Colorado School of Mines. For complete objectivity, College Swimming utilizes a Power Point system in lieu of team-submitted entries, and have done so since 2013. Northern Colorado is the second-highest ranked women's program from the Western Athletic Conference, one place behind Grand Canyon.
